Last wednesday I had the final talk with the surgeon before going under the knife, possibly in January. Once I'm back from Bangkok and FFS, I'm supposed to give them a call so that they can start scheduling the surgery (it's a public hospital and covered by GID treatment, so it does not work as in a private clinic).


The talk was about confirming what I wanted done: round implants, a bit bigger than the media, and with an armpit incission.I don't like anatomics and they would imply a ful under breast incission, since I haven't developed areolas.

So, he agreed to do it, but he told me that he may still need to do a small underbreast incission to expand the pocket from there. it's the first time I hear about something like this. Is this normal or he lacks the ability to create a full pocket from the armpit?


The rest of it, the standard: Silicon gel implants,  which can be moderate, moderate plus or high profile, and uner the muscle. They haven't told me which ones will use or the size, since they will try with the test implants while I am under anaesthesia. Supposedly they are aiming for the most natural look (and pissed off that I don't want anatomics).
